A have SB X-Fi xtreme audio notebook (express card)  (CA0110-IBG) and
it's working on 13.10, but was't without some changes in settings (12.04
and 12.10 need this too. 10.04-11.10 card was warking out of the box I
think). In terminal type: alsamixer -> press F6 to change sound card to
X-Fi -> Disable (!!!) <Auto-Mute> -> unmute channels you want by
pressing 'm'. You may need also:  sudo alsa force-reload
